photo print is blown out

Trying to print a photo from Elements 2018:  I Placed it in a blank document, set the default for PHOTO - it looked good on the screen, did no editing on it and went straight to PRINT.  I'm printing on an Epson 620, which I have used for printing photos for years.  The result was a blown out version of the photo, with a subtle color shift.  To confirm that all was working in my basic system, I took the same photo and imported it into iOS Photos app on my MacBook Pro, did no editing on it, hit PRINT, it came out as expected.  What settings am I missing in Elements to have a photo print the way I would expect?

Is this a recent development?

Go to Image>Mode and be sure that RGB Color is checked.

Does PSE or the printer manage colors on your set-up? We don't want both. Go to Edit>Color Settings and check Optimize Colors for Computer Screens.

Go to File>Print>More options (at the bottom)>Color Management tab>Color Handling and in the drop-down check Printer Manages Colors.

Are you using both Epson paper and Epson ink?

Also, has there been an update for the printer driver? Check on Epson web site.
